Kate Resti Scholarship

In 2014 friends and family of Catherine Resti established a scholarship to be known as the Kate Resti Memorial Scholarship. The scholarship is available for Hancock Central School students through the Hancock Community Education Foundation.

Catherine (Kate, as many of her friends called her) passed away on February 14, 2014 in Honesdale, PA, after bravely battling cancer. She was born on June 21, 1966, in Queens, New York and moved to Equinunk, PA, when she was ten, where she lived with her life-long love and partner, James Dibble, until her death.

Kate graduated from Hancock High School and worked at St. Clair Graphics in Honesdale with her childhood friend, Beth St. Clair, for almost thirty years. She was extraordinarily gifted and talented, especially as a golfer, playing as often as weather permitted and competing regularly in tournaments. She took particular delight in competing in and sometimes winning men’s tournaments. Kate loved to travel and could often be seen in the summer floating down the Delaware in a tube with her friends and relatives or lying in the sun at Lake Como at her brother, Patrick’s house. If anything could be said about her, it is that she lived her life in the way that she wanted.
